Smarty = most power with coolest egts.

That is step 3 however.

Step 1 is gauges - at very minimum an egt gauge

Step 2 is either a clutch or upgrades to the 48re if an auto.

He can runner lower settings on the Smarty with the stock tranny, but if he's anything like me, he wont' be able to resist the temptation to load the higher power settings and then he is playing with fire with a stock auto or clutch.
